What are the key cost and capacity factors shaping China's hydroxylamine sulfate market?
Production economics vary significantly by route. The butanone oxime process offers lower manufacturing costs and is becoming the dominant method for hydroxylamine salts, while the nitro-methane route is more expensive and less competitive. Capacity utilization data from Jiangsu Aikewei, a major producer planning to add 20,000 tons of hydroxylamine sulfate and 10,000 tons of hydroxylamine hydrochloride capacity, reveals market softness: utilization dropped from 142.96% in 2022 to 53.69% in H1 2024. This mirrors broader industry trends where post-2021 supply disruptions caused price spikes, but recovery of competitor output and weaker downstream demand have pressured operating rates. The company's oxime silane products, which share feedstock chains, also saw price declines as competition intensified. New capacity additions across the sector risk further eroding utilization unless downstream agrochemical and pharmaceutical demand accelerates.
